The NRL's final 2021 squad listings have been officially announced after this week's mid-season transfer deadline passed.
The Roosters have rewarded a trio of emerging NRL regulars with new two-year-deals, with Billy Smith, Drew Hutchison and Fletcher Baker re-signing until the end of 2023.
For Hutchison and Smith especially, the extensions come after long-term injury battles that limited their first-grade opportunities.
The future is bright at Bondi Junction with teen tyro Joseph Suaalii having options in his favour to extend his two-year deal at the Roosters into 2023 and 2024.
At the Dragons, Hunt has opted into the final year of his deal for 2023 while centre Zac Lomax's has done likewise with his long-term deal, enacting the final-year option in his in favour for 2026.
Kaufusi remaining at Melbourne is another boost for the premiers on the back of the recent deals announced for fullback Ryan Papenhuyzen and coach Craig Bellamy.
Fogarty was already locked in at the Titans for another 12 months but will remain at the club until the end of 2023, while Gold Coast prop Herman Ese'ese has taken up his 2022 option.
Warriors livewire Reece Walsh has a 2024 clause in his favour, as do Parramatta pair Mitchell Moses (2024) and Maika Sivo (2023).
For the August 2 deadline for 2021 rosters to be finalised, each club is able to carry up to two players who had their contracts terminated, as agreed in the amended CBA.
